Output 2fc6104b5d8f3e194d128d0dc97e6700ea49cd330ef3a181840b6aee9821fe5e:42

value
1104000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8a0e32acd971bfef7c8fdfc372a4dae5949f5336 OP_EQUAL
address
3EGzBWNWSiJqLgeUQ2pWAYvVawGe74ib1y
transaction
2fc6104b5d8f3e194d128d0dc97e6700ea49cd330ef3a181840b6aee9821fe5e
spent
true